倾斜煤层巷道断面形状适应性研究

摘  要:煤层倾角影响巷道断面形状选择。采用数值分析方法,分析倾斜煤层不同断面类型巷道的破坏形式,发现拱形巷道围岩稳定性明显好于直边巷道;近水平煤层适合选择矩形断面,缓倾斜及倾斜煤层适合选择倒梯形断面,大倾角煤层适合选择异形断面,当围岩地质条件较差时选用拱形或斜拱形断面,急倾斜煤层适合选择梯形断面。The dip affects roadway cross-sectional shape choosing.Based on statistics,we use numerical analysis method to study failure modes corresponding to the section of roadway under different inclination conditions.Studies have shown that:surrounding rock stability of arched tunnel is significantly better than a straight edge roadway.Gently inclined and inclined seam for selection inverted trapezoidal cross section,for selecting high inclined seam profiled section,when the selection of poor geological conditions surrounding rock arch arched or oblique section,Steep Seam suitable choice trapezoidal cross section.
